Background Information
NGRN, also named as Neugrin or FI58G, is a 291 amino acid protein, which belongs to the neugrin family. NGRN localizes in the nucleus and is expressed at high levels in heart, brain and skeletal muscle. In brain, it is mainly expressed in neurons rather than glial cells. NGRN may be involved in neuronal differentiation.
